Retired Govt Servant To Undergo 2 Yrs RI For Taking Bribe

Bhubaneswar: Special Judge, Vigilance, Sambalpur today sentenced retired former senior clerk of the District Police Office, Sambalpur Hari Shankar Nai to undergo rigorous imprisonment (RI) for a period of two years after convicting him for demanding and taking bribe.

The court also slapped a fine of Rs 10,000 on Nai. In default of payment of the fine Nai has to undergo further rigorous imprisonment for a period of six months,, said an official press release.

The court further sentenced him to undergo rigorous imprisonment for a period of one year and to pay a fine of Rs 5,000 and in default to undergo further rigorous imprisonment for a period of three months for the offence under section 7 of the PC Act, 1988. The court ruled that both the sentences are to run concurrently.

Nai had demanded and accepted bribe from the complainant for processing her nomination roll and was charge sheeted by the Vigilance under sections 13(2) read with 13(1) (d) and 7 of the PC Act of 1988.

The Vigilance will now move the competent authority to stop the pension of Nai following his conviction
